Output 43ff9dc084c243d56d08d5bb653de0dbd59f1d6f95ba306cacf478ecc3e98d6f:3

value
154888569
script pubkey
OP_0 OP_PUSHBYTES_20 cd3a8bf0d01881a87b7ea171b2da3428aaec937a
address
bc1qe5aghuxsrzq6s7m759cm9k359z4weym6j30328
transaction
43ff9dc084c243d56d08d5bb653de0dbd59f1d6f95ba306cacf478ecc3e98d6f
spent
true